POSITION: Creative Content Producer

EMPLOYER:  The Chartered Institute of Export & International Trade (CIOE&IT)

POSITION STATUS:  Full Time
REPORTS TO:  Executive Editor
LOCATION:  London Office

SALARY BANDING:  £40,000 - £45,000 per annum

 

THE ROLE

The Chartered Institute of Export & International Trade is looking to appoint a new Creative Content Producer within its Corporate Affairs department.

The Creative Content Producer will create engaging multimedia content for use across the Chartered Institute’s major external channels, including social media, web, events and newsletters. They will also manage the Chartered Institute’s social media channels, co-creating and implementing an overarching strategy and focused campaigns to grow the Chartered Institute’s reach and number of relevant followers.

The successful candidate will report to the Executive Editor within the Editorial Content team and work closely with colleagues across the wider organisation including Events, Marketing and Public Affairs. They will need to have a proven ability to produce content at pace and across multiple formats including written, video and audio.  Experience of delivering high quality video content, editing and post-production is essential.

They will have a keen interest in international trade, politics or business and will ideally have previously worked in a B2B or similar context.

 

RESPONSIBILITIES: 

 

  • Produce original engaging content that raises awareness of the Chartered Institute’s international trade expertise, thought leadership and services.
  • Film or record engaging multimedia content that showcases the variety of experts at the Chartered Institute and the depth of their expertise – including the Director General.
  • Film or record engaging content featuring the broader international trade ecosystem, including the Chartered Institute’s members and key partners, as well as political and business leaders.
  • Produce content to high editorial and accessibility standards.
  • Work with colleagues to optimise how multimedia content is presented on our website and YouTube channel.
  • Produce and edit a variety of formats – from 30-second reels to longer-form ‘podcast style’ videos – using Adobe Creative Cloud (including Premiere Pro and After Effects) or similar software programmes.
  • Produce and repurpose content into a variety of formats and media – including written, video and audio – that can be used across the Chartered Institute’s wide array of channels and projects.
  • Play a key role in shaping the organisation’s broader multimedia and editorial strategies, bringing insights about the latest innovations and trends in digital content.
  • Assist on commercial projects by producing multimedia content for clients.
  • Develop and implement social media strategies to increase brand awareness and engagement across relevant channels – particularly LinkedIn, working closely with the Editorial Content and Media Relations teams.
  • Manage the day-to-day coordination of the Chartered Institute’s social media channels, liaising with colleagues and partners on scheduling.
  • Track and measure KPIs on social media using performance analytics and report success of campaigns.
  • Keep in touch with latest social media best practices and ensure colleagues adhere to them.
  • Educate and support colleagues throughout the company on how to raise their own social media profiles while adhering to the Chartered Institute’s high professional standards and brand guidelines.
